Energy efficiency
Double glazing has been proven scientifically to be a great way to limit heat loss and gain in homes. It can help to reduce the flow of heat during winter and also prevent unwanted solar gain in summer, which can reduce the amount of energy you use. This results in lower energy bills and lower carbon footprint. A well-insulated house can keep warm longer and use less heating. This will help you save money over time.
The air between two panes glass in a double-glazed window acts as an effective insulation. It slows down the transference of heat from the home to the outside. Air molecules cannot transfer heat as efficiently as glass. This is the reason double glazed windows are more energy efficient than single-glazed windows.

Condensation control
Condensation can give surfaces like floors and walls an unpleasant smell, which can cause mildew spores to circulate and negatively impact woodwork. Double glazing reduces condensation by keeping the interior surface of the glass warm. However, if windows are not set up correctly, moisture could get through the gaps between panes and damage the window seal. Moisture can also form between the frame and the glass, if the window is affixed to an existing brick wall. In these situations replacing the entire window is required.
Condensation in the panes of windows with double-glazed glass is usually caused by a defective seal. This could be due to the aging of the sealant, which allows air to enter the window's space and reacts with the moisture in the air to form condensation. Rubber strips are typically used as a sealant in windows with double glazing that are cheaper than of silicone, which could accelerate condensation.
A professional double-glazing installer will ensure that the sealant around the edges of the frames is properly applied and the gaps are sealed to stop cold air from getting into your home. They should also provide a comprehensive service after the installation to ensure that you are happy with their work.

Double glazed windows can cause condensation to form on the outside. This is an indication of a window that is thermally efficient and performing well. This kind of condensation usually occurs late at night or in the morning, when temperatures are low and there is little wind. Installing extractor fans in kitchens and bathrooms, as well as using a dehumidifier within the home can reduce the amount on condensation.

The British double-glazing industry is competitive and homeowners can pick an array of styles and colors for their new windows. The top companies provide high-quality windows and offer different financing options and warranties. They should be able to provide a no-cost consultation, without obligation. They should be fully insured for work on your property. They should also be a member of the Glass and Glazing Federation (GGF) and be registered with FENSA. The GGF provides a complaint-handling procedure that seeks to settle disputes between installers and consumers.
